Higher Education in Afghanistan

Introduction

Generally, when a girl or boy goes to school actually they are pupil and supports by Ministry of Education. Ministry of Education covers students from first grad up to twelve, when students graduated from high school and by passing college entrance exam legitimately they enter to higher education system of Afghanistan which runs by Ministry of Higher Education. Higher education of Afghanistan consists of Universities and institutions of higher education and the universities are including faculties and faculties are divided in different departments. Those students who get high scores they go faculties like medical, engineering, law and pharmacy and those who get the medium score they absorb in faculties like language and literature, agriculture, economy, etc. and those students who get the lower score in the entrance exam they absorb in teacher training institutions which study for tow years .

Before the intervention of Soviet Union 1978, Afghanistan had a very well defined system of education that evolved over a century to that state. There were tow universities, Kabul University and Nangarhar University. The main university was Kabul University made of a dozen colleges (faculties). Nanngarhar University was mainly a medical college; in the later years several other colleges were added to make it an in depended university. There were several teacher training institutions around the country that were accepting high school graduates. There were also few other special / vocational training institutions that were accepting graduates of high schools. (UNECO Press)

If we glance to historical perspective of higher education in Afghanistan we will see that higher education have had the great effects on people’s lifestyle and people life-condition. For example those people who had the chance to enter in universities and continue their higher educations now they are in high position in the society and they can decide about people predestination. Nowadays the most significant and valuable thing which come in field of higher education are internet and computer, these facilities has brought change in field of study and teaching in Afghanistan universities, now all professors and students are able to share their knowledge to other universities and other scholars. For instance, a few years ago all professors or lecturers had to prepare lecture note to students and the students had to write it down or copy, but nowadays every students or professors can find their subjects and items via internet.(Aina Magazine)

In conclusion, higher education in Afghanistan sustained many difficulties during the Soviet Union invasion or after its invasion (during the Mujahidin period and Taliban term). But after Sep. 11, 2001 gradually change comes to higher education system in Afghanistan, especially when computer involved the curriculum of teaching. According to estimation of researcher in field of higher education, they believe that since, technology involved in higher education of Afghanistan the eligible change come to style of teaching lectures of professors. Now teachers present their lectures by power point and other facilities of Microsoft products. Finally, these changes are going on positively, and it insures a better future for higher education of Afghanistan.
